import os

cwd = os.getcwd()

print("Current working directory: {0}".format(cwd))

# Print the type of the returned object
print("os.getcwd() returns an object of type: {0}".format(type(cwd)))

os.chdir(r"C:\Users\ghph0\AppData\Local\Programs\Python\Python39\Bootcamp\PDFs")

# Print the current working directory
print("Current working directory: {0}".format(os.getcwd()))

Hi all, I was changing my file directory so I could access specific files and was then greeted with this error:

SyntaxError: (unicode error) 'unicodeescape' codec can't decode bytes in position 2-3: truncated \UXXXXXXXX escape

From there I did some research and was told that converting the string to raw would fix the problem. My question is why do I convert it to raw and what does it do and why does it turn the file path into a red colour(not really important but never seen this before). Picture below:

https://i.stack.imgur.com/4oHlC.png

Many thanks to anyone that can help.

Backslashes in strings have a specific meaning in Python and are translated by the interpreter. You have surely already encountered "\n". Despite taking two letters to type, that is actually a one-character string meaning "newline". ANY backslashes in a string are interpreted that way. In your particular case, you used "\U", which is the way Python allows typing long Unicode values. "\U1F600", for example, is the grinning face emoji.

Because regular expressions often need to use backslashes for other uses, Python introduced the "raw" string. In a raw string, backslashes are not interpreted. So, r"\n" is a two-character string containing a backslash and an "n". This is NOT a newline.

Windows paths often use backslashes, so raw strings are convenient there. As it turns out, every Windows API will also accept forward slashes, so you can use those as well.

As for the colors, that probably means your editor doesn't know how to interpret raw strings.
